Student Services

A college is a true community, a living and learning environment that students call home during their college careers. An array of student services is made available helping students:
  • to achieve their full academic potential
  • to receive academic and personal assistance when needed
  • to grow and develop in character and personal abilities
  • to live in a safe, healthy and positive campus environment

In this section, we highlight the offerings of a number of departments at Loyola dedicated to these goals:

Academic Advising and Support Center

From freshman placement testing to the review of graduation requirements, the Center works with students to plan their educational programs through an extensive advising system and provides services to help students with the challenge of Loyola’s classroom work.

Loyola Writing Center

Operated by the Writing Department, the Writing Center offers resources and trained writing tutors to improve academic papers in every stage of development, from developing initial ideas to assistance with grammar and proofreading.

Counseling Center

The Counseling Center’s professional and dedicated staff helps students needing counseling assistance and also sponsors educational programs for the college community.

Alcohol and Drug Education and Support Services

This department promotes informed and healthy lifestyle choices through individual work with students, group work and campus education.

Office of Disability Support Services

This office provides programs, services and support to students with disabilities. Our goal is to facilitate access to Loyola’s programs and activities and to eliminate barriers of any type.

Student Health and Education Services

This department operates Loyola’s on-campus clinic, provides referrals and sponsors a number of health education programs and support groups focusing on certain health issues.

Office of Leadership and New Student Programs

This office sponsors our extensive Summer Orientation Program and other offerings for new students and provides a number of programs to help students develop their leadership skills.

Department of Public Safety

The Campus Police work seven days a week, 24 hours per day to protect our campus. Officer patrol, electronic surveillance of public places, the escort service and other activities are all designed to help meet this goal.
